What Is Wooden Pallets Clearance?

Wooden pallets clearance describes the process of managing the surplus or unwanted wooden pallets that collect in storage facilities and warehouse. Whether due to over-purchasing, damaged goods, or changes in supply chain operations, companies often find themselves with excess inventory that need to be dealt with effectively. Clearance may include reselling, recycling, or repurposing these pallets to minimize waste and recover costs.

Why Is Wooden Pallets Clearance Important?

  1. Cost Savings: Unused pallets use up important space, which can result in increased storage expenses. Clearance helps businesses conserve cash by maximizing warehouse space.
  2. Environmental Responsibility: Wooden pallets can contribute to garbage dump waste if not gotten rid of effectively. By clearing and recycling pallets, businesses can help in reducing their ecological footprint.
  3. Safety: Accumulated pallets can position security hazards in the office. An organized clearance procedure ensures a safer environment for staff members.
  4. Resource Optimization: By clearing unneeded pallets, companies can much better assign their resources and improve their functional performance.

Steps for Effective Wooden Pallets Clearance

  1. Examine Inventory: Conduct an extensive stock audit to determine the quantity and condition of the pallets.
  2. Classify Pallets: Sort pallets based on their condition: recyclable, recyclable, or harmed.
  3. Choose a Clearance Method: Select the most appropriate alternative from the table above based on your service requirements and objectives.
  4. Carry Out the Clearance Plan: Execute the plan, ensuring all needed logistics are in place, including transport and marketing if selling.
  5. Follow Up: After the clearance, evaluate the process to identify improvements for future clearances.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. What types of wooden pallets can be cleared?

Answer: Most frequently, wooden pallets used in shipping and storage can be cleared. This includes basic size pallets (like 48" x 40") in addition to custom-sized pallets based upon particular company requires.

2. How can I figure out the value of used pallets?

Answer: The worth of used pallets depends upon their condition, size, and regional demand. Online marketplaces can offer insights into rates based on similar items.
